Q: Can I still breastfeed even if I had gestational diabetes when I was pregnant?
A: Yes. The very term, gestational diabetes, means the sickness is only present during the pregnancy. There is no direct correlation between gestational diabetes and breastfeeding. In fact if a mom is breastfeeding, she also protects herself longer from different life threatening illnesses, diabetes included.
